Ian's love for the four legged creatures and this big blue planet inspired him to start the Ian Somerhalder Foundation.
As the website says, it's mission "aims to empower, educate, and collaborate with people and projects to positively impact the planet and its creatures". They are currently working on an animal sanctuary which is pretty awesome. But don't think they only care about the "big" things. Ian knows every life, animal or human, is precious so ISF is offering finanical help for emergency animal care. This grant program helps organizations and us regular folk afford medical procedures for our furry friends that would otherwise be too expensive for us, leaving the animals without vital care.
